Hi, Try this one. 1 ¾ cups whiskey/brand/wine (whatever you prefer, but buy cheap) 1 x 14pz can sweetened condensed milk 1 cup whipping cream 4 eggs 2 tablespoons instant coffee granules 2 tablespoons chocolate syrup 2 teaspoons vanilla extract 1 teaspoon almond extract Stick it all in the blender Pour into a bottle and secure tightly Pop it in the fridge Lasts up to a month. Shake the bottle before you drink. Another one is to substitute Camp coffee instead of the coffee granules and chocolate syrup. Just be careful how much alcohol you put in other wise you will be flat on your back! Aileen xxx Have found a cheap wine based version is Irish Knight which is under £3 I believe in Asda and I usually get a few bottles of that in for Xmas. |

here's another recipe 2 tsp Instant Coffee Tin condensed milk 1/2 pt (284ml) double cream 1 1/2 pt (852ml) single cream Bottle (70cl) cheap Brandy or Whisky 2 tsp Glycerine Dissolve coffee in 1/2 cup of hot water. Mix condensed milk and all of the cream. Whisk. Add Brandy and Glycerine. Whisk. Pour into clean bottles and refrigerate. Shake before serving. Sufficient to make 2 1/4 litres of Baileys. Please note; If you are on a diet you can use skimmed condensed milk! Penny |

Mines on a much larger scale , a 2 litre coke bottle + one large glassful to test its worked:) HOME MADE BAILEYS 4tsp coffee granules 1 tin unsweetened condensed milk(don't want too many calories) 1/2 pt double cream 1 1/2 pt single cream 1 bottle whisky/brandy 2tsp glycerine Dissolve coffee in hot water Mix condensed milk and all cream Whisk Add Brandy and Glycerine Whisk again Decant into bottle and drink whats left over. Hic! You can make a beautiful White Russian with this recipe. WHITE RUSSIAN Equal measures of homemade Baileys, Vodka and Tia Maria Now you understand why I don't remember much of the Millenium celebrations!
